1. Choose the Right Theme:

One of the first steps in customizing your website is selecting a suitable theme. WordPress (the platform for bloggers) offers a wide range of free and premium themes that can cater to various niches and preferences. Before choosing a theme, consider factors such as design, responsiveness, customization options, and user reviews. Look for a theme that aligns with your brand identity and provides the flexibility to modify its appearance to match your vision.

2. Customize Your Theme:

Once you have selected a theme, it's time to make it your own. Customizing your theme allows you to personalize your website and create a unique online presence. WordPress (the blogging platform) provides built-in customization options that enable you to modify the header, footer, colors, fonts, and more. Additionally, you can add custom CSS code to tweak the design further. For advanced customization, consider using a child theme to avoid overriding your changes during theme updates.

3. Leverage Plugins:

One of the greatest advantages of using WordPress is the availability of plugins. These powerful additions extend the functionality of your website without the need for coding skills. Whether you want to add a contact form, implement search engine optimization (SEO) strategies, or integrate social media sharing buttons, there is a plugin for almost everything. However, be selective with plugins and avoid installing unnecessary ones, as they can slow down your website's performance.

4. Optimize for Speed:

Page loading speed is crucial for user experience and search engine rankings. Slow websites tend to have higher bounce rates and may lose potential visitors. To optimize your website's speed, start by choosing a reliable hosting provider. Additionally, compress and resize images before uploading them, enable caching, and minimize the use of external scripts and plugins. Regularly monitor your website's performance using tools like Google PageSpeed Insights or GTmetrix, and make necessary adjustments to enhance its speed.

5. Regularly Update WordPress and Plugins:

WordPress and its plugins are constantly updated to improve performance, fix bugs, and address security vulnerabilities. It is crucial to regularly update your WordPress installation and installed plugins to benefit from these updates and maintain the security and functionality of your website. Automatic updates can be enabled for minor WordPress releases, but make sure to thoroughly test your website after updating to prevent compatibility issues.

6. Ensure Website Security:

Security is paramount for any website owner. WordPress is known for its robust security features, but taking additional precautions is recommended. Start by using strong and unique passwords for your WordPress admin and hosting accounts. Additionally, keep your plugins, themes, and WordPress version up to date to mitigate security risks. Regularly back up your website's files and database to a secure location and consider using a security plugin to scan for malware and protect against brute force attacks.

7. Optimize Your Website for SEO:

Search engine optimization plays a crucial role in driving organic traffic to your website. WordPress offers many SEO-friendly features out of the box, such as clean URLs, customizable meta tags, and easy integration with popular SEO plugins. Install a reputable SEO plugin like Yoast SEO or All in One SEO Pack to optimize your content, generate XML sitemaps, and improve your website's visibility in search engine results.

9.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):

Q1. How can I find suitable themes for my WordPress website?

A1. You can browse the official WordPress theme directory or explore third-party marketplaces for a wide selection of themes. Consider factors like responsiveness, design, and user reviews before making a decision.

Q2. Are free plugins as reliable as premium ones?

A2. While there are excellent free plugins available, premium plugins often come with dedicated support and additional features. Evaluate your requirements and budget before choosing between free and premium plugins.

Q3. How often should I update my WordPress installation and plugins?

A3. It is recommended to update your WordPress installation and plugins as soon as new updates are released. Regular updates help keep your website secure and ensure compatibility with the latest versions.

Q4. How can I improve my website's SEO?

A4. Focus on creating high-quality, relevant content, optimize your meta tags, use descriptive URLs, and improve page loading speed. Install an SEO plugin to simplify the optimization process and analyze your website's performance.

Q5. How do I backup my WordPress website?

A5. Many hosting providers offer automated backup solutions. Alternatively, you can use plugins like UpdraftPlus or manually export your website's files and database using cPanel or a dedicated backup tool.
